During the second-quarter earnings call, Martin Lau, President of Tencent Holdings, disclosed that the company has amassed a substantial inventory of AI GPU chips to cater to future model training requirements, thus ruling out the short-term acquisition of NVIDIA H20 or other Western AI chips. This decision is grounded on four pivotal factors: Firstly, Tencent possesses ample GPU stock to facilitate model upgrades; secondly, for inference tasks, the company can opt for non-Western chips; thirdly, software optimization enhances computing power utilization; and fourthly, NVIDIA chips have yet to secure Chinese government security clearance. Furthermore, Tencent's capital expenditure for the second quarter amounted to RMB 19.11 billion, marking a 119% year-on-year surge, primarily allocated towards infrastructure, data center, and AI-related developments. Despite this surge in AI investment, Tencent has demonstrated remarkable resilience and financial robustness, with revenue and net profit growing by 15% and 11%, respectively, in the second quarter.
